unbekannt15 Posted March 9, 2008 Posted March 9, 2008 (edited) You can reinstall almost all.I had removed Windows file system filter manager, but I needed it for WinBuilder. I inserted my WinXP CD, searched for the file wimfltr.sy_ , copied it to C:\ and in the cmd I wrote:expand C:\winfltr.sy_ C:\winfltr.sysIt is important to use the expand command and not rename them.After that copied it to C:\WINDOWS\system32Restart and finish.If it is a .dll or .ocx file you'll have to register it. Start->Run->regsvr32 dllname.dllYou have to search the file(s) on your Windows CD and that is the problem. Not every filename is as simple as winfltr.sy_.
